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an on Thursday made his first official visit to Athens since 2017, telling his Greek counterpart that he believes that "a new era" is dawning in relations between their two countries, Report informs, citing DW.
Erdogan said he aimed to nearly double bilateral trade volume to $10 billion (€9.3 billion) from $5.5 billion currently.
